EEE graduate student Andres Valero received the International Organisation of Vine and Wine (OIV) grant totaling over $10,000.

The OIV is an inter-governmental organization that includes 45 countries for the scientific and technical reference concerning vines, wine, wine-based beverages, table grapes, raisins and other vine-based products.

Each year, the organization selects a graduate student to develop a short-term research project in what the organization classifies as priority fields.

Valero was selected for his research entitled “Sustainable Wine Scoring System Under a Regional Ecosystem Framework for Increasing Consumer Awareness”. The main objective of his research is to develop a Sustainable Wine Scoring System (SWSS) in order to provide a benchmark for different regions, wineries, and wine sustainable performance, providing an “easy-to-understand” representation of wine’s sustainable attributes to consumers.
